
Ijen Crater Blue Fire & Sunrise Adventure
Description
Embark on an unforgettable midnight adventure to witness the world-famous blue fire phenomenon at Ijen Crater. This challenging trek takes you to the edge of one of Indonesia's most active volcanoes, where you'll observe sulfur miners at work, experience the magical blue flames, and enjoy breathtaking sunrise views from the crater rim. Located at 1,238 meters above sea level, Ijen is home to the world's largest acidic lake and one of only two blue fire sites on Earth.
